Я пытаюсь сбалансировать нагрузку на маршрутизатор для отправки трафика по двум восходящим каналам (с одинаковой пропускной способностью). Я сгенерировал статические маршруты для каждого / 8 в Интернете (для ipv4) и подключил его. К сожалению, это не дает желаемого эффекта. Я заметил, что при проверке таблицы переадресации для определенного IP-адреса было три маршрута, два моих статических / 8 и один более конкретный маршрут (/ 24 вместо / 8), который был изучен через bgp. Может ли кто-нибудь подтвердить, что Junos будет направлять трафик по более конкретному маршруту, даже если он был обнаружен из менее предпочтительный источник например, BGP по статическому маршруту, введенному вручную.
это источник предполагает, что способ обучения маршрута всегда выбирается первым (пункт 2 после проверки ссылки активен)
Выберите путь с наименьшим значением предпочтения (предпочтение процесса протокола маршрутизации).
1.0.0.0/8 и 1.0.0.0/24 (например) не являются одним и тем же маршрутом, поэтому нет конкуренции между двумя / 8 и одним / 24 за попадание в FIB. Два / 8 входят, и когда он изучает / 24, он тоже входит, потому что он более конкретен (так что другой маршрут). Вы не можете отклонить / 8 из-за наличия / 24, не могли бы вы (вы бы пропустили большую часть / 8)?
Кроме того, почему вы генерируете / 8 для каждого блока в адресном пространстве IPv4, когда вы можете просто сгенерировать два маршрута 0/0? (Предполагая, что один вышестоящий провайдер!). Сказав это, я не могу помочь вам заставить вашу балансировку нагрузки работать, так как я недостаточно знаю о JunOS.